Zum Hauptinhalt springen

Dateinamen extrahieren

Aufbau

ExtractFileName(sFileName: Text): Text

Typ

Funktion

Beschreibung

Diese Funktion extrahiert den Dateinamen und die Dateiendung aus einem vollständigen Pfad, der Verzeichnis, Dateinamen und Dateiendung enthält. Im Grunde genommen beginnt diese Funktion, von rechts nach links zu lesen, und setzt das Funktionsergebnis zusammen, bis sie auf ein „\“- oder „/“-Zeichen stößt.

Parameter: 1

sFileName = der Name des vollständigen Verzeichnisses + Dateiname + Dateiendung

Rückgabewert

Text

Beispiele

ShowMessage(ExtractFileName('C:\test\subdir\MyFile.PDF'))

ShowMessage(ExtractFileName('http://mywebserver.com/somedir/MyFile.PDF'))

' Beide würden anzeigen: 'MyFile.PDF' |